In Illinois, the severe temperature swings between hot summers and freezing winters necessitate robust window performance. Cold air infiltration during winter months can significantly increase heating bills, while summer heat can make homes uncomfortable and drive up cooling costs. Properly sealed and insulated windows are crucial for managing these energy demands. In Illinois, the demand for window installations often decreases during the colder months. This can sometimes lead to more competitive pricing from installers looking to maintain workflow. However, performing installations in extreme weather can present challenges. The most practical time is often during the spring and fall shoulder seasons.

Replacing 20-year-old windows in Illinois is often a worthwhile investment. Older windows may have degraded seals, poor insulation, and inefficient glass, leading to significant energy loss and higher utility bills. Upgrading can improve comfort, reduce heating and cooling costs, and enhance your home's overall value, especially in challenging climates like Chicago's.
